Police respond to mental health crisis at Clinton apartmentClinton MA

Battista Ct, Clinton, MA 01510

According to the dispatch call, police responded to reports of screaming and banging at an apartment near Battista Court. Officers forced entry after no response and found a person who needed a mental health evaluation. EMS was called to assist with the involuntary psychiatric evaluation under a Section 12 order.

Police codes explained
The following codes appeared in the transcript and are explained below:
[1]
Section 12: Involuntary emergency psychiatric evaluation or transport under Massachusetts law (MGL c.123 §12).
